Through design, validation and manufacturing

Visit us at Railtex Hall 3, Stand J31

We believe that by reducing the weight of vehicles and developing solutions for energy efficient products we can minimise the use of precious resources.

We do this because we are passionate about reducing fuel use and emissions and we want to model what innovative, responsible manufacturing looks like.

About us

IRIS, ISO 9001 and DIN 6701 approved, TRB Lightweight Structures has over 60 years experience in the design and manufacturer of high-quality rail interiors, door leaves and detrainment systems. We work closely with our customers to produce products that can stand up to the demanding rail environments over the life of the vehicle.

Our knowledge of both rail standards and requirements ensures a smooth development and approval process.

With facilities in the UK, Europe and USA, we are able to maintain quality and deliver finished products to an exceptionally high standard.

We have a team of experienced CAD design engineers who design a range of components and structures taking your ideas from concept through to reality.

We provide a range of in-house validation and testing. By using complete FEA analysis, physical load tests, mock-up manufacture, prototype build and cyclic testing this helps ensure reliability and safety.

Whether low volume or large scale production, our manufacturing principles deliver a consistently high quality product within short lead times.

  • FULLY EQUIPPED PRODUCTS MADE WITH COMPOSITE MATERIALS
  • ROLLING STOCK REFURBISHMENT AND REVERSE ENGINEERING
  • INTERIOR, EXTERIOR, DETRAINMENT, EGRESS AND CAB SECURITY RAIL DOORS

Award winning* - COMPOSITE DOOR LEAVES - THE NEXT GENERATION

TRB has developed a new biocomposite resin based carbon fibre reinforced (CFRP) sandwich panel door leaf with a 100% recycled foam core. The door leaf is a sustainable, ‘green’ composite material option for carriage door leaves at a comparable cost to aluminium bonded door leaves, with a 35% weight saving. The composite structural system easily passes BS 6853 and BS 476 Part 7 Class 1a and is EN 45545 HL3 compliant.


*Environmental/Sustainability Award at the Composites UK 2018 Industry Awards

BACK